I'm blessed to be living quite close to where I work in Islington, and the first I heard about this was when I was walking to work and bumped into some colleagues who told me about the explosions, and when I got in to the office was told this was because of power surges and that some people had phoned in to explain they'd be late, and there were others whom we hadn't heard from. Everyone calling in was advised to go home. About this time the phones were badly affected,so parents were distraught about not getting through to their children's schools.
So everyone was a little distracted this morning, and one meeting was postponed because we'd only be talking about what was going on outside, rather than work.
We had a radio on in my section all day tuned to radio London to listen to updates. Everyone was really shocked about the bus explosion, I guess because the damage was more visible, because it seemed to escalate the attack, and because the buses were so full with people evacuated from the underground. Plus when a friend of mine came in after eleven she told us that she'd been on the bus in front after getting out at Holburn.
We are told that it was always a question of "when", not "if", but having had "it" now doesn't mean there won't be a repeat tomorrow.
